2011 DZD to AED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2011

During 2011, the DZD to AED ex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on April 29, valuing the pair at 0.0517.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on December 29, dropping to 0.0484.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0033 AED.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0500 to the December average rate of 0.0490, the exchange rate registered a net change of -1.99%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2011 high of 0.0517 was up 0.40% compared to the 2010 peak of 0.0515,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0514 0.0490 0.0500
February 0.0508 0.0500 0.0504
March 0.0511 0.0503 0.0508
April 0.0517 0.0501 0.0511
May 0.0517 0.0506 0.0510
June 0.0514 0.0506 0.0510
July 0.0510 0.0501 0.0506
August 0.0511 0.0501 0.0506
September 0.0506 0.0492 0.0498
October 0.0504 0.0488 0.0497
November 0.0500 0.0491 0.0495
December 0.0494 0.0484 0.0490
